  1. October 15, 2012

    University Loses Bid For Einstein Publicity Rights In GM Suit

    A California federal judge on Monday dismissed Hebrew University of Jerusalem's suit against General Motors LLC over the carmaker's use of Albert Einstein's image in a commercial, ruling the university no longer holds the rights of publicity 57 years after the physicist's death.

  2. August 29, 2012

    Einstein's Publicity Rights Questioned In GM Ad Suit

    A California judge overseeing an Israeli university's suit against General Motors LLC over its use of Albert Einstein's image in magazine advertisements questioned attorneys Wednesday whether the school's claim to Einstein's publicity rights should survive 57 years after the physicist's death.

  3. August 07, 2012

    Israeli University Fires Back At GM In Einstein Ads Row

    An Israeli university suing General Motors LLC over its use of Albert Einstein's image in magazine advertisements asked a California federal court on Tuesday to rule in its favor, arguing GM's defense had relied on precedent that didn't apply to commercial ads.

  4. March 19, 2012

    GM Can't Dodge Publicity Rights Suit Over Einstein Ad

    A California federal judge on Friday refused to dismiss an Israeli university's lawsuit over General Motors LLC's use of Albert Einstein's image in magazine advertisements, ruling that the school might have inherited the famed physicist's publicity rights.
